Olivier wrote: > 1. With IMAP, is it necessary to save a copy of voicemails in /var/log > files so that a user can still listen to his (or her) own voicemails > with his own hardphone ?
no listening your voicemails are only stored in the IMAP folder and accessed from both the email client and the phones. The cool thing is that they are only marked read/deleted/... once so you listen to a message on the phone and your corresponding "email" is instantly marked read. > 2. How then, can you make sure to skip non-voice mails stored in the > same email repository ? I usually put voicemail in a separate imap folder but I am sure it also works with only one inbox.
